GPAT 2023 answer key: The Graduate Pharmacy Aptitude Test (GPAT 2023) answer key for both shifts 1 and 2 will soon be out by the National Agency (NTA). The exam will be held on May 22, 2023. Along with the answer key, the candidate can also download the question paper and response sheet from the official website — nta.ac.in — — gpat.nta.nic.in

---Advertisement---

NTA has also informed that candidates who appeared in the pharmacy entrance exam can also challenge the provisional answer key by paying a non-refundable fee of Rs 200 per question challenged. After reviewing all the objections, the final answer key and the result will be released.

GPAT 2023: Marking Scheme

As per the marking scheme, for every correct answer candidates will be rewarded with 4 marks and for every incorrect answer 1 mark will be deducted. If candidates didn’t attempt the question then no marks will be given. The question paper will carry a total of 125 questions of 500 marks in total. Last year, the GPAT cut-off was 148.
